Turmeric Curcumin formulations combined with ginger and probiotics are a popular, multifunctional supplement category in the UK for 2026. These blends aim to support healthy digestion and a balanced gut microbiome while offering natural anti-inflammatory effects associated with curcumin and ginger. UK consumers increasingly choose products that deliver clinically standardised curcumin extracts, bioavailability enhancements (for example piperine or advanced delivery systems), clear probiotic strain and CFU labeling, and clean, allergen-free ingredient lists. Practical buying factors that drive preference include third-party testing, vegetarian or vegan formulations, sustainable packaging, and transparent dosage guidance. This category appeals both to people seeking everyday digestive comfort and to those looking for complementary support for joint and general inflammatory wellness, making it a versatile choice for a broad adult audience.

Science and Evidence — A Beginner Friendly Summary
Research into curcumin, ginger, and probiotics shows complementary, evidence-based benefits for digestion, inflammation markers, and gut health. Curcumin, the active compound in turmeric, has been studied for anti-inflammatory and antioxidant effects in clinical trials. Ginger is supported by studies for easing nausea, improving gastric motility, and reducing digestive discomfort. Probiotics have a growing evidence base for supporting microbiome balance and improving specific digestive conditions such as irritable bowel syndrome and antibiotic-associated diarrhoea. Important practical points are that probiotic benefits are strain specific and dose dependent, and curcumin absorption is naturally low unless paired with proven bioavailability strategies. Together these ingredients can be synergistic for general gut comfort and inflammation management, but results vary by individual and formulation.
Curcumin: Clinical trials and meta-analyses report reductions in inflammatory markers such as C-reactive protein and symptomatic improvements in some inflammatory conditions, though doses and formulations matter.
Ginger: Evidence supports ginger for reducing nausea and aiding digestion by improving stomach emptying and reducing intestinal cramping in some people.
Probiotics: Randomised trials show certain strains can help with symptoms of IBS, reduce duration of antibiotic-associated diarrhoea, and support overall microbiome diversity; strain specificity and colony forming unit (CFU) count are key.
Bioavailability: Curcumin has low natural absorption. Combining curcumin with piperine (black pepper extract), using phospholipid complexes, or liposomal delivery can greatly increase blood levels and potential effectiveness.
Safety and interactions: These supplements are generally well tolerated in adults, but curcumin can interact with blood thinners and some medications. Pregnant or breastfeeding people and people with serious health conditions should consult a healthcare professional before starting supplements.
